GENERAL PRODUCT ISSUES ------------------------ A) EasyTree B) Font Issues C) SnapShot A) EasyTree Issue: Family file: Rebuilding the index takes time -- especially with large files. Solution: Generations only rebuilds the index if the application doesn't close properly. If you don't want to wait for this, hold down the shift key while opening a file to avoid building an index. Issue: Date feasibility checking doesn't understand a date format of straight numbers -- 010484, for example. Solution: This is one date format that Generations won't be able to read. However, the manual dedicates 10 pages to dates, date formats, and custom dates. Please refer to the manual and or On-line help to make sure you're using the correct date formats. Issue: HTML reports can be quite large Solution: When you transfer any file to HTML format, the size of the HTML file is going to be 1.5 times more then the original file because HTML adds tags and markup frames to the text. You should be aware of this before posting to the web if you have space limitations on your web site. Issue: Copied document is truncated after 60 characters in the Memo field. Solution: You can type in more than 60 characters into the memo field. You can also cut and paste, but you must do so line-by-line. If you try to cut and paste a full multi-line text, it will be truncated after 60 characters. B) FONT ISSUES Issue: In EasyChart, fonts over 36 characters get clipped in timeline charts. Solution: There are some font styles that don't size well in timeline charts. If you are encountering this problem, simply try a different font style. This should resolve your problem. Issue: Changing the font in "EasyChart" changes the format of the tree and boxes. Solution: EasyChart needs to make adjustments to accommodate larger point size fonts as well as styles. Experiment with larger font styles and sizes prior to making major changes to your layout. Issue: You can make the text too large for the boxes which in some cases will print outside of the text box borders or print off the edge of the chart. Solution: We've tried to accommodate as many sizes as possible. The more information you enlarge, most likely you won't see everything displayed. Try enlarging the chart by right-clicking on the small black box and dragging the chart either left to right or top to bottom. The black box can easily be found at the bottom of the chart. Change the view to 10:1. Issue: In EasyTree, data gets cutoff if Windows is set to use Large Fonts Solution: Although we've worked hard to support large fonts in many fields, there may be some places where text appears to be cutoff. The information is still there. Switching to small fonts will correct this problem. Otherwise click on More Info to bring up a dialog screen with entire information or you many need to resize the boxes or scroll back and forth within the text box, title box or field itself. Issue: Type 1 (Adobe) PostScript fonts are not showing up in my list of display fonts to choose from; only TrueType (TT) fonts are. Solution: Generations doesn't support Type 1 Adobe PostScript fonts. C) SNAPSHOT ISSUES Issue: After the SnapShot installation is done, choose to install Web Publishing Wizard. After it is done copying, choose to restart. When SnapShot spawns a restart window, choose to restart later. Two windows appear asking you if you wish to restart. Solution: Web Publisher is a separate MS install and cannot be changed at this time. The first restart window is from Web Publisher, and the second window is needed for the SnapShot. Just cancel the Web Publisher window and restart with the remaining window.
